Assurance Wireless Quick Facts
A factual snapshot without fake ratings, fake reviews, or guaranteed tablet claims.
| Provider type | Lifeline-supported wireless provider |
|---|---|
| Network | T-Mobile network, coverage varies by area |
| Main offer | Lifeline phone service with talk/text/data for eligible users |
| Tablet options | May be available only when offered; not guaranteed |
| Eligibility paths | SNAP/EBT, Medicaid, SSI, FPHA, Veterans/Survivors benefit, income-based Lifeline |
| BYOP | Bring your own compatible unlocked phone may be an option |
| Application/status | Use official Assurance Wireless site or account tools |
| Important note | Device approval, model, data, coverage, and costs vary by state/ZIP/current terms |

Eligibility
Assurance Wireless Eligibility: EBT, SNAP, Medicaid, SSI and Income
You may qualify for Lifeline-supported Assurance Wireless service through qualifying benefit programs or household income. Final eligibility and device availability depend on application review, ZIP code, state rules, and current provider terms.
Lifeline generally allows one benefit per household. Texas and Oregon may have special eligibility or National Verifier handling, so applicants in those states should follow official instructions carefully.
SNAP / EBT
Medicaid
Supplemental Security Income (SSI)
Federal Public Housing Assistance (FPHA)
Veterans Pension / Survivors Benefit
Income at or below 135% of the Federal Poverty Guidelines
Tribal programs where applicable
One Lifeline benefit per household rule
State-specific rules may apply
Application proof
Documents Needed for Assurance Wireless
Required documents can vary by National Verifier, state system, or provider process. Prepare proof before starting an Assurance Wireless application so you do not delay review.
Government ID
Proof of address
Proof of SNAP/EBT, Medicaid, SSI, FPHA, veteran benefit, or income
Household worksheet or household details if required
Last four SSN or identity details if required by the official application flow
Proof may be requested by National Verifier, state system, or provider process
